Anybody know the size limit for HTTP headers? I found this article on the bea.com site.
"HTTP Max Message Size
Specify the maximum HTTP message size allowable in a message header. This attribute attempts to prevent a denial of service attack whereby a caller attempts to force the server to allocate more memory than is available thereby keeping the server from responding quickly to other requests. This setting only applies to connections that are initiated using one of the default ports (ServerMBean setListenPort and setAdministrationPort or SSLMBean setListenPort). Connections on additional ports are tuned via the NetworkChannelMBean.
MBean: weblogic.management.
configuration.ServerMBean
Attribute: MaxHTTPMessageSize
Units: bytes
Minimum: 4096
Maximum: 2000000000
Default: -1
Configurable: yes
Dynamic: yes"
